Default Crosman 66 Powermaster pivot pin removal

I have a Crosman Model 66-A1 Powermaster I got from my father in the mid 1970's. The plunger cup failed and I am trying to get the pin out so I can service it. It isn't a roll pin like every single one online, but similar to a rivet with a c-clip. I have attached some pics. I have tried using a hammer and line punch with penetrant and let it sit overnight and it will still not budge. Any help will be greatly appreciated.
